American Clothing Express, Inc. et al v. CloudFlare, Inc. et al
Plaintiff: American Clothing Express, Inc. and Justin Alexander, Inc.
Defendant: Does 1-200 and CloudFlare, Inc.
Case Number: 2:2020cv02007
Filed: January 6, 2020
Court: US District Court for the Western District of Tennessee
Presiding Judge: Samuel H Mays
Referring Judge: Diane K Vescovo
Nature of Suit: Copyright
Cause of Action: 17 U.S.C. § 101
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ff
